Episode 47: Tax Issues for Cryptocurrency Transactions, featuring Ted Mlynar and Ira Schaefer
This week, Online Editor Christina Sauerborn and Guest Tax Correspondent Jessica Drake talk with Ted Mlynar and Ira Schaefer, Partner and Senior Counsel, respectively, at Hogan Lovells LLP. Ted and Ira previously chatted with us back in Episode 38 about blockchain technology and smart contracts. In this episode, they are back to discuss the many taxation issues of cryptocurrencies and cryptocurrency transactions, focusing on the limited guidance from the IRS and what taxpayers may need to report by April 17.
